Wärtsilä disclosed an initial insider transaction notification for Nora Steiner-Forsberg (Other senior manager), reported on 22-Jul-2026 on NASDAQ Helsinki. The filing provides the transaction date and role but no deal size/price in the provided text, implying limited immediate information for investors.

Analysis

A single senior-manager share filing is usually weak alpha unless it is large, repeated, and clearly open-market. In this case the more important market read is not the transaction itself but the absence of any evidence that management is signaling a step-change in fundamentals; most such prints are noise from compensation, taxes, or portfolio housekeeping.

For WRT1V, the real drivers remain backlog conversion, mix, and margin discipline in marine/energy exposure. If the company is entering a better booking cycle, the stock should respond to order intake and guidance revisions over the next 1-3 months; if not, this insider event will be forgotten quickly. The second-order effect is that any perceived insider confidence could slightly support sentiment, but it does nothing to de-risk execution or working-capital volatility.

Contrarian view: the market often over-weights insider activity when it lacks size/context, especially in mid-cap industrials where liquidity is thin and narrative can move the tape. Without follow-on buying from multiple executives, this should be treated as a no-trade signal rather than a buy signal. The thesis is falsified if subsequent filings show a cluster of meaningful purchases or if upcoming results show order/margin inflection that the market is not yet pricing.
